The Core Components of a Reliable Login
A reliable financial login typically combines several layers of verification to confirm your identity. These components work together to prevent unauthorized access while maintaining a user-friendly interface.
Secure username and password combinations.
Two-factor authentication via SMS or authenticator apps.
Biometric options such as fingerprint or facial recognition.
Device recognition and trusted browser settings.

Troubleshooting and Recovery Options
Most modern banking platforms offer intuitive recovery paths to minimize downtime. These tools are designed to verify your identity without compromising security.
Password reset links sent to registered email addresses.
Security questions and backup phone verification.
Temporary access codes delivered via SMS or email.
Customer support assistance for complex lockouts.

The Role of Artificial Intelligence in Login Security
Artificial intelligence has transformed how institutions monitor and respond to login attempts. By analyzing patterns in user behavior, AI systems can detect anomalies that may indicate fraud. This proactive approach allows for real-time interventions, such as blocking suspicious access or prompting additional verification before granting entry.
Benefits of AI-Driven Authentication
AI enhances security while improving the overall customer journey by reducing friction.
Continuous risk assessment based on login context.
Reduced false positives compared to rigid rule-based systems.
Adaptive learning that evolves with emerging threats.
Faster approval for trusted users and devices.
